Job Purpose
The Head of Investment is responsible for overseeing and managing the investment portfolio of the life insurance company. This executive role involves developing and implementing investment strategies that align with the company's financial objectives, risk tolerance, and regulatory requirements. The position requires a deep understanding of financial markets, asset management, and the unique investment needs of a life insurance entity.
Main Responsibilities
- Formulate and execute investment strategies that align with the company's financial goals and policyholder obligations.
- Conduct thorough market research and analysis to identify investment opportunities and risks.
- Oversee the management of the company's investment portfolio, ensuring optimal asset allocation and performance.
- Monitor portfolio performance and make adjustments as necessary to meet financial objectives.
- Identify, assess, and manage investment risks in line with the company's risk appetite and regulatory guidelines.
- Develop and implement risk mitigation strategies to protect the company's assets.
- Ensure all investment activities comply with local and international regulatory requirements.
- Maintain up-to-date knowledge of relevant laws and regulations affecting investment practices.
- Lead and mentor the investment team, fostering a culture of high performance and continuous improvement.
- Set clear objectives, provide regular feedback, and support professional development.
- Communicate investment performance, strategies, and risks to senior management, the board of directors, and other stakeholders.
- Prepare and present detailed investment reports and analyses.
Qualifications and Experience
- Bachelor's degree in Finance, Economics, Business Administration, or a related field.
- Advanced degrees (e.g., MBA) or professional certifications such as Chartered Financial Analyst (CFA) are highly desirable.
- Minimum of 10 years of experience in investment management, with at least 5 years in a leadership role within the insurance or financial services industry.
- Proven track record of developing and implementing successful investment strategies.
- In-depth knowledge of investment principles, asset allocation, and portfolio management.
- Strong analytical and quantitative skills, with the ability to interpret complex financial data.
- Excellent leadership and team management abilities.
- Effective communication and presentation skills.
- High level of integrity and ethical standards.
This role is pivotal in ensuring the financial stability and growth of the company through strategic investment management and effective risk oversight.
Similar jobs